Misophonia (or selective sound sensitivity syndrome) is a disorder of decreased tolerance to specific sounds or their associated stimuli, or cues. Misophonia is when certain sounds trigger unusually strong emotions, body changes or reactive behaviors. Misophonia, often misunderstood or overlooked, is a neurophysiological syndrome where specific sounds provoke intense emotional and physiological responses.
